Tsimshian vs Immigrants from Portugal Single Mother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 15,606,004 people shows a moderate negative correlation between the proportion of Tsimshian and poverty level among single mothers in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.442 and weighted average of 26.8%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 171,376,513 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Portugal and poverty level among single mothers in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.260 and weighted average of 30.5%, a difference of 13.7%.
